The Advanced Diploma of Remedial Massage (Myotherapy) is a hands on course. You will learn the physical assessment and treatment skills needed for the preventative, corrective and rehabilitation phases of musculoskeletal care.
This course builds on the skills taught in the Diploma of Remedial Massage so you can work with more complex cases. You will increase your employability in the industry by gaining skills in:
- leadership and counselling
- finance management in small business
- clinical assessment
- myotherapy practice
- myotherapy treatments including dry needling

Careers
Upon completion you will be eligible to register for Provider Number status with private health insurers and WorkCover, and with one of the Professional Massage Associations across Australia. You will be able to work in the following areas:
- self employed and as an independent Myotherapist
- as a part of an Allied Health Practice or health organisation
- health spas
- gyms and sporting clubs
- hospitals or aged care facilities

To gain the award of Advanced Diploma of Remedial Massage (Myotherapy) participants must complete all eleven (11) units of
competency, made up of six (6) common units and five (5) specialist units.
Participants who do not complete the full course will be awarded a Statement of Attainment listing those units they have successfully completed.

Admission Information
- Year 12: VTAC Completion of the Certificate IV/Diploma of Remedial Massage or equivalent.
- Mature: VTAC Completion of the Diploma of Remedial Massage or equivalent. Applicants are encouraged to apply and may be required to have relevant employment or evidence of experience and/or ability to meet the demands of the program.
